The AGM 2010 was held on <b>August 10</b> and draft minutes of that meeting exactly say
"The Chairman replied that we have plans to make <b>significant</b> changes relating to education and examination which include development of study packs for students. The Vice President explained that the Examination Committee has come up with lot of recommendations in the last meeting of the Council. The Council has in principle agreed with most of the recommendations. These recommendations are <b>approved</b> by the Council in principle to improve the results without compromising on the quality. <b>The Institute will announce the reforms in education and examination shortly.</b>
